As of the recent trading session ending 2026-04-03, Banco De Chile ADS (BCH) trades at $36.38, marking a 2.31% decline from its prior closing price. This analysis covers key market context, technical support and resistance levels, and potential short-term scenarios for the Latin American banking ADS, as investors weigh broader macroeconomic trends alongside technical price action.
